Animal tracks are a window into an otherwise be a hidden world of wild animals. Animals are all around us, but many are stealthy, shy, and seldom seen. To a trained tracker however, there are signs of life everywhere. Animal tracks (also called animal footprints, pugmarks, traces, spoor, impressions, etc) are a powerful tool for learning about the wildlife around you. Becoming an animal tracker will completely change the way you see the world. With a little effort and guidance, anyone can identify many clear animal tracks and signs with ease.
